A mid-20th century Vietnamese silver mounted glass tea tray with cups and saucers, circa 1960
Rectangular gorm with embossed mounts of trees, sailing ships and distant mountains. The saucers of octagonal form with chased and pierced foliate edge, the centres engraved with a shou symbols. The Chinese porcelain cups painted with Chinese dragons chasing the mystic pearl, the silver mounts forming a dragon form handle. The saucers marked Vietnam and 0.900, also with Russian Soviet era control marks (post-1958), control marks to cup mounts, tray unmarked.
Tray length – 45 cm / 17.75 inches
Weighable silver – 316 grams / 10.16 ozt
